Key Factors Affecting the Durability of Steel Structure Buildings
Steel structure buildings are widely used in modern construction because they offer high strength, fast installation, flexible layout, and reliable long-term performance. From a commercial steel building and industrial steel building to a steel warehouse building, showroom, workshop, office building, or agricultural facility, steel structures can be designed for many different project needs.
However, the durability of a steel structure building depends on more than the steel itself. A long-lasting building requires proper material selection, anti-corrosion protection, professional structural design, quality manufacturing, standard installation, and regular maintenance.
Anti-Corrosion Protection Is Essential
Corrosion is one of the main factors that affects the service life of steel building structures. Moisture, industrial dust, acid-base air, salt spray, and poor drainage may cause rust on steel surfaces over time.
To improve durability, steel components should receive suitable anti-rust treatment before installation. Common methods include anti-rust painting, hot dip galvanizing, primer coating, and special coating systems for coastal or humid environments.

Structural Design Affects Long-Term Safety
A durable steel structure building must be designed according to real load conditions. Wind load, snow load, seismic requirements, roof load, wall load, and equipment load should all be considered during the early design stage.
For a steel frame structure building, the design of steel columns, beams, bracing, purlins, and beam-column connections is very important. A reasonable structural system can reduce stress concentration and improve overall building safety.

Roof, Wall, and Insulation Systems Matter
The durability of steel structures is also closely related to the roof and wall system. Good roof panels, wall panels, gutters, downpipes, and waterproof details help protect the building from rainwater leakage and long-term corrosion.
For commercial buildings, offices, showrooms, supermarkets, and workshops, insulation for steel building projects is also important. Proper insulation can reduce heat transfer, improve indoor comfort, control condensation, and support better energy efficiency.

Manufacturing and Installation Quality Cannot Be Ignored
For a prefabricated steel structure building, factory manufacturing quality directly affects installation accuracy and long-term performance. Steel components should be accurately cut, welded, drilled, coated, inspected, and packed before shipment.
During site installation, columns must be aligned correctly, bolts must be tightened properly, bracing must be installed according to drawings, and roof and wall panels must be fixed securely. Any coating damage during installation should be repaired in time to prevent rust.

Regular Maintenance Extends Building Service Life
Steel structure buildings usually require less maintenance than many traditional buildings, but regular inspection is still necessary. Building owners should check coating condition, rust spots, bolts, fasteners, roof panels, wall panels, gutters, downpipes, doors, windows, and waterproof joints.
After strong wind, heavy snow, or heavy rain, an additional inspection is recommended. Small problems such as loose screws, blocked gutters, or damaged coating should be repaired early before they become serious issues.
